Développeur et Intégrateur Linux Embarqué

il y a 1 semaine


BoulogneBillancourt, Île-de-France Netatmo Temps plein
Job Description

L'équipe Logiciel Embarqué est en charge de la conception, du développement et du test du logiciel tournant sur tous nos produits. En son sein, l'équipe Caméra à Boulogne-Billancourt (14 personnes) est spécialisée dans les produits Linux embarqué. Elle est composée de deux sous-équipes, Système (7 personnes) et Middleware (6 personnes).

En tant que Développeuse·eur et Intégratrice·eur Linux Embarqué, vous êtes en charge :

  • de l'intégration, de la cross-compilation et de la maintenance du système d'exploitation et des différentes briques logicielles bas niveau ;
  • du développement de scripts, de briques logicielles métier bas niveau et de différents outils internes.

Vous travaillez aussi bien avec les équipes R&D internes (Électronique, Industrialisation, Test, Cybersecurité, Support Client mais aussi Cloud, Qualité et applications Mobile) qu'avec les Chefs de Produits et qu'en externe avec des fournisseurs de composants, des laboratoires de certification, des auditeurs et divers partenaires et sous-traitants.

En tant que Développeuse·eur et Intégratrice·eur Linux Embarqué, vos principales responsabilités sont les suivantes :

  • Conception, intégration et maintenance de notre plateforme Linux embarqué, devant être la plus modulaire possible tout en garantissant un niveau élevé de sécurité ; celle-ci étant utilisée sur plusieurs produits ;
  • Développer principalement en Shell & C, un peu plus ponctuellement en C++ moderne (C++17 et bientôt C++20), en Rust et en Python pour nos outils ;
  • Contribuer aux spécifications et à l'architecture logicielle du système d'exploitation ;
  • Participer à la conception de nouveaux produits, au bring-up des prototypes, à la qualification et validation du hardware jusqu'à à l'amélioration continue de l'existant.

Périmètre technique de l'équipe Système :

  • Le périmètre technique part du bootloader et va jusqu'au userspace en passant par le Kernel & drivers, le système d'init, le Secure Boot. Se rajoutent la responsabilité du mécanisme de firmware update, du Buildsystem (Buildroot), de la CI (Gitlab), et l'intégration des SDK/BSP des fournisseurs ;
  • Participation à la phase de qualification & validation hardware des nouveaux produits ;
  • Travail conjoint avec l'équipe Test aux outils de validation exécutés sur la chaîne de production à l'usine ;
  • Support à l'industrialisation (nouveaux produits, nouveaux batchs, changements de composants, etc.) ;
  • Support à l'équipe hardware (principalement l'équipe électronique) pour la qualification et la validation de PCB et nouveaux composants ;
  • Certifications (CE, FCC, Wi-Fi Alliance, Bluetooth SIG, etc.) ;
  • Suivi des releases firmwares.
Qualifications

Vous êtes la personne idéale si :

  • Vous êtes diplômé(e) d'une école d'ingénieur ou équivalent ;
  • Vous avez une première expérience en environnement Linux Embarqué (Intégration et développement) ;
  • Vous maîtrisez le fonctionnement d'un système Linux, de Git et avez un bon niveau en (C ou C++) et en shell ;
  • Vous avez de bonnes connaissances en compilation, toolchains, gcc/clang et outils de compilation type Make, Autotools ou Cmake ;
  • Vous avez déjà pu pratiquer Buildroot ou Yocto ;
  • Vous avez des connaissances réseau et Kernel Linux ;
  • Vous avez un niveau professionnel à l'oral et à l'écrit en français et en anglais. La langue orale de l'équipe et de la R&D est le français. Le développement, la documentation, la revue de code se fait en anglais ;
  • Vous êtes une personne rigoureuse / organisée / communicante et dynamique avec un bon esprit de synthèse.

Extra :

  • Vous avez une expérience préalable dans l'électronique grand public et/ou des connaissances des contraintes d'industrialisation et de tests en usine ;
  • Vous avez des connaissances en électronique (Lecture de schematics, de datasheets, utilisation d'outils de mesure / debug).

Même si vous ne cochez pas toutes les cases, n'hésitez pas à postuler.

Additional Information

Avantages :


• Remise salariés sur l'achat de produits Netatmo & produits partenaires : chaudière, radiateurs électriques.


• Remise de produits reconditionnés Netatmo


• Un intéressement de 4% si objectifs atteints.


• Une participation en fonction des résultats.


• Prime de vacances


• Remboursement des frais de transports à hauteur de 50%


• Café/Thé offert


• Accès au Restaurant Inter-Entreprise & foodcourt/ tickets restaurants


• Accès au CE Netatmo


• Accès à la plateforme Learning with Legrand avec de nombreuses formations disponibles


• CET : compte épargne temps


• Horaires flexibles


• Télétravail


• Mutuelle 100% dématérialisée : Alan ‍


• Mobilité interne possible


• Pendant les pauses tu peux jouer au Ping-pong & Babyfoot


• Tous les midis des activités sportives (, , , course, spikeball ... )


• Salle de sport dans les locaux (avec douche )


• Plusieurs jeux de société à disposition


• Evènements réguliers (afterwork, soirée de noël...)


• Des bureaux incroyables avec un toit et une vue sur la Tour Eiffel


• Parking pour votre voitureet votre vélo ‍ sous réserve des places disponibles



  • Boulogne-Billancourt, Île-de-France ALTEN Temps plein

    Quelles sont les missions ?Au sein d'un grand groupe en charge du Développement de Box (internet, TV), nous sommes à la recherche d'un(e) Ingénieur(e) Etudes et Développement C/C++ embarqué Linux.Vous travaillerez en collaboration avec le/la de projet et vous aurez pour rôle :-L'analyse des besoins du client;-La conception, le développement et...


  • Boulogne-Billancourt, Île-de-France ALTEN Temps plein

    Quelles sont les missions ?Au sein d'un grand groupe en charge du Développement de Box (internet, TV), nous sommes à la recherche d'un(e) Ingénieur(e) Etudes et Développement C/C++ embarqué Linux.Vous travaillerez en collaboration avec le/la de projet et vous aurez pour rôle :-L'analyse des besoins du client;-La conception, le développement et...


  • Boulogne-Billancourt, Île-de-France ALTEN Temps plein

    Quelles sont les missions ?Au sein d'un grand groupe en charge du Développement de Box (internet, TV), nous sommes à la recherche d'un(e) Ingénieur(e) Etudes et Développement C/C++ embarqué Linux.Vous travaillerez en collaboration avec le/la de projet et vous aurez pour rôle :-L'analyse des besoins du client;-La conception, le développement et...


  • Boulogne-Billancourt, Île-de-France Alten Temps plein

    Description du poste Au sein d'un grand groupe en charge du Développement de Box (internet, TV), nous sommes à la recherche d'un(e) Ingénieur(e) Etudes et Développement C/C++ embarqué Linux . Vous travaillerez en collaboration avec le/la de projet et vous aurez pour rôle : L'analyse des besoins du client; La conception, le développement et...


  • Boulogne-Billancourt, Hauts-de-Seine, France agap2IT France Temps plein

    Développeur logiciel embarqué H/F - secteur de la DEFENSEDEVELOPPEMENT – ILE DE FRANCE – CDINationalité française nécessaire, ce poste nécessitant une habilitation particulièreagap2 IT est une société européenne de conseil spécialisée en développement et gestion de projets informatiques. La réputation d’agap2 IT s’est construite grâce...


  • Boulogne-Billancourt, Île-de-France Netatmo Temps plein

    Job DescriptionPosition: Embedded Linux Developer and Integrator at NetatmoNetatmo's Embedded Software team is responsible for designing, developing, and testing the software running on all our products. Within the team, the Camera team in Boulogne-Billancourt (14 people) specializes in embedded Linux products. It consists of two sub-teams, System (7 people)...

  • Administrateur Linux

    il y a 1 semaine


    Boulogne-Billancourt, Île-de-France Informatis Temps plein

    Dans le cadre d'un important projet avec un groupe leader dans son domaine, nous recherchons un Administrateur Système LINUX.Intégré à l'équipe Run Linux et encadré par son responsable, vous êtes en charge de- Maintien en condition opérationnelle des infrastructures Linux / Unix en production.- Traitement des incidents et requêtes.- Installation et...


  • Boulogne-Billancourt, Île-de-France INFORMATIS Temps plein

    Dans le cadre d'un important projet avec un groupe international leader dans son domaine, nous recherchons un Administrateur Système Linux.Intégré(e) au sein de la Direction Opérations dans l'équipe Run Linux, vos missions seront:- Maintien en condition opérationnelle des infrastructures Linux / Unix en production,- Traitement des incidents et...

  • Développeur GO Fullstack

    il y a 7 jours


    Boulogne-Billancourt, Île-de-France Davidson consulting Temps plein

    Profil / Mission Afin de renforcer nos équipes, nous recherchons un développeur fullstack. Au sein d'une équipe agile, ta mission consistera à : Étudier et analyser des différents besoins pour définir conjointement l'architecture à mettre en place Développer les différentes fonctionnalités Prendre en compte la logique de déploiement...

  • Développeur PHP Symfony

    il y a 8 heures


    Boulogne-Billancourt, Île-de-France EASY PARTNER Temps plein

    Missions Développer de nouvelles fonctionnalités priorisées par l'équipe produit Proposer des évolutions et optimisations pour améliorer le produit (robustesse et performance) Participez à la modernisation du code vers une architecture en micro-services Participer activement à la vie de l'équipe et aux cérémoniaux agiles Veille technologique...


  • Boulogne-Billancourt, Île-de-France Apside Temps plein

    de l'offre d'emploiEnvie de rejoindre une entreprise apprenante ? Engagée pour t'accompagner dans ton évolution professionnelle et dans tes projets personnels ?Rejoins Apsid'EA pour travailler sur nos projets Software de demain Le posteEn assistance technique, tu rejoins nos équipes pour contribuer à la réussite de nos projets auxquels tu apporteras tes...

  • Développeur d'application

    il y a 3 semaines


    Boulogne-Billancourt, Île-de-France OPENCLASSROOMS Temps plein

    Quelles sont les missions ?Vos missions en tant que Développeur d'application - Java - en alternance : - Réaliser les travaux de conception et de développement en garantissant la bonne intégration des fonctionnalités dans la solution logicielle. - Intégrer une équipe pluridisciplinaire (Product Owner, Développeurs et testeurs). - Avoir la...


  • Boulogne-Billancourt, Île-de-France OPENCLASSROOMS Temps plein

    Quelles sont les missions ?Vos missions en tant que Développeur d'application - Java - en alternance : - Réaliser les travaux de conception et de développement en garantissant la bonne intégration des fonctionnalités dans la solution logicielle. - Intégrer une équipe pluridisciplinaire (Product Owner, Développeurs et testeurs). - Avoir la...

  • Développeur d'application

    il y a 8 heures


    Boulogne-Billancourt, Île-de-France OPENCLASSROOMS Temps plein

    Quelles sont les missions ?Apprenez un métier d'avenir en alternance avec OpenClassrooms.OpenClassrooms recherche un Développeur d'application - JavaScript React en contrat d'apprentissage pour l'un de nos partenaires du secteur de l'entreprise, pour préparer une de ses formations diplômantes reconnues par l'État.Attention : Cette offre ne s'adresse...


  • Boulogne-Billancourt, Île-de-France SUEZ Temps plein

    Type de contratCDIQUI SOMMES-NOUSLa Business Unit globale SUEZ Smart & Environnemental Solutions (SES) a pour vocation d'accélérer le développement et le déploiement des solutions smart et environnementales à l'échelle mondiale. Afin de répondre à un marché en croissance et qui devient hautement concurrentiel, la BU SES se structure autour de deux...

  • Développeur Sage X3 H/F

    il y a 1 semaine


    Boulogne-Billancourt, Île-de-France Michael Page Temps plein

    Le poste de Développeur Sage X3 H/FEn tant que Développeur Sage X3 et sous le Responsable hiérarchique du Responsable des Études Informatiques, vous serez intégré à l'équipe de développeurs sur Sage X3 et vous aurez la charge du support technique et des développements sur leur périmètre applicatif.Sur la partie support : * Vous assurez la...


  • Boulogne-Billancourt, Île-de-France VIVERIS Temps plein

    Viveris pilote les chantiers de transformation métier et IT qui contribuent à la performance de ses entreprises clientes.Dans ce cadre, nous recherchons un Développeur Fullstack Java Angular débutant, qui interviendra dans un contexte Agile.Vos missions : Développer le front en technologie Angular ;Participer et intervenir dans des ateliers techniques...

  • Développeur JAVA Angular H/F

    il y a 3 semaines


    Boulogne-Billancourt, Île-de-France VIVERIS Temps plein

    Viveris pilote les chantiers de transformation métier et IT qui contribuent à la performance de ses entreprises clientes.Dans ce cadre, nous recherchons un Développeur Fullstack Java Angular débutant, qui interviendra dans un contexte Agile.Vos missions : Développer le front en technologie Angular ;Participer et intervenir dans des ateliers techniques...

  • Développeur Java H/F

    il y a 1 semaine


    Boulogne-Billancourt, Île-de-France Apside Temps plein

    de l'offre d'emploiEnvie de rejoindre une entreprise apprenante ? Engagée pour t'accompagner dans ton évolution professionnelle et dans tes projets personnels ?Rejoins Apsid'EA pour travailler comme développeur JAVA (H/F) Le poste ?Intégré(e) au sein d'une équipe à taille humaine, pour le compte de notre client, tu participes à l'ensemble des phases...

  • Développeur Sage X3 H/F

    il y a 1 mois


    Boulogne-Billancourt, Île-de-France MICHAEL PAGE Temps plein

    Quelles sont les missions ?En tant que Développeur Sage X3 et sous la Responsable Hiérarchique du Responsable des Études Informatiques, vous serez intégré à l'équipe de Développeurs de Sage X3 et vous aurez la charge du support technique et des développements sur leur périmètre applicatif.Sur la partie support : * Vous assurez la gestion des...